The Clinical Usefulness of Axial OMU CT in ESS for Chronic Sinusitis / 대한이비인후과학회지

ABSTRACT
BACKGROUND AND

OBJECTIVES:

OMU CT scans are taken on a direct coronal plane for chronic sinusitis and thus allows evaluation only from the coronal plane. However, axial OMU CT provides view of the surrounding vital structures, variation of air cells, and the anterior to posterior relations of structures associated with chronic sinusitis. We investigated the clinical usefulness of axial OMU CT in chronic sinusitis. MATERIALS AND

METHODS:

A prospective study was performed in 100 sinuses of 50 patients with chronic sinusitis who underwent endoscopic sinus surgery from May through July of 1998.

RESULTS:

We observed that axial OMU CT has the advantage of evaluating the outline of the lateral lamella of lamina cribrosa, anterior and posterior ethmoid canal, optic nerve in sphenoid sinus, internal carotid artery in sphenoid sinus, Onodi cell, and anterior to posterior relations of these structures.

CONCLUSION:

We found that, in chronic sinusitis, axial OMU CT is effective in evaluating the important vital structures, normal variation, and the relations between the structures and that it can help prevent complication during ESS. We therefore recommend axial OMU CT to be included in the routine radiological evaluation for ESS in chronic sinusitis.
